Great to meet you!

Hi, I’m Olivia, a Licensed Professional Counselor who believes therapy should be a space where you can show up as you are—even when life feels messy, overwhelming, or hard to put into words. I have experience supporting children, adolescents, and adults navigating trauma, anxiety, depression, grief, life transitions, and overwhelming emotions. My approach is warm, collaborative, and trauma-informed, with a focus on helping clients better understand themselves, build practical tools for coping, and create meaningful change at a pace that feels manageable. I hold a master’s degree in clinical mental health counseling and strive to offer a space where clients feel genuinely heard, supported, and respected.

My approach to therapy

My approach to therapy is warm, collaborative, and tailored to each client’s unique needs and goals. I draw from evidence-based approaches, including c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), attachment-based therapy, and trauma-informed care, while recognizing that therapy is not one-size-fits-all. I work with clients to better understand the connections between their thoughts, emotions, experiences, and patterns, while also building practical tools to navigate life outside of the therapy room. I believe meaningful growth happens through a balance of compassion, curiosity, and gentle challenge, and I strive to create a space where clients feel supported while working toward lasting change.

What you can expect from me

In our first session, my priority is getting to know you and beginning to understand what brings you to therapy, what feels most important right now, and what you hope to gain from our work together. You can expect a welcoming, nonjudgmental environment where there is no pressure to share more than you feel ready to discuss. Together, we’ll begin identifying your goals and exploring what support might be most helpful, while leaving room for those goals to grow and change over time. My hope is that you leave the first session feeling heard, supported, and with a clearer sense of what our work together could look like.
